Brown bin service suspended

Tewkesbury Borough Council have said, "Due to the weather this week normal bin collections didn’t happen on Wednesday so the refuse collectors are a day behind meaning that garden waste collections have been suspended this week.

Side waste can be left in black bags next to your bin on the next collection but the bags must be open so that the refuse collectors can see inside."

TBC apologise for any inconvenience caused. 


When the service resumes, brown bin users will be able to use the service to recycle Christmas trees (just the real ones!).  Just put it out for collection on your scheduled garden waste collection day along with your green bin and TBC will collect it for you. They ask that, if it is larger than six foot, you cut it in half.

If you're not signed up to the brown bin service, you can recycle your real Christmas tree at the Hempsted amenity site, Over Farm Market or a number of garden centres in the area, listed here.
